Summary
Hepatocellular carcinoma (HCC) is a common cancer with increasing incidence. Early detection through advanced imaging allows for curative treatments like surgery or transplantation, improving patient survival and quality of life.

Background:
- Hepatocellular carcinoma (HCC) is a globally prevalent malignancy with rising US incidence.
- Historically poor prognosis for HCC is improving due to earlier detection methods.
- HCC accounts for approximately one million deaths annually worldwide.
Purpose of the Study:
- To review the current therapeutic landscape for Hepatocellular Carcinoma (HCC).
- To emphasize the importance of early detection in improving HCC patient outcomes.
- To outline the rational application of diverse treatment modalities for HCC.
Main Methods:
- Review of current literature on HCC diagnosis and treatment.
- Analysis of therapeutic options including surgery, transplantation, and local ablative therapies.
- Discussion on the criteria for selecting appropriate HCC treatments.
Main Results:
- Early HCC detection via improved imaging and surveillance enables curative treatment options.
- Partial hepatectomy and liver transplantation offer potentially curative therapies for select HCC patients.
- Local ablative therapies provide palliation for unresectable HCC.
Conclusions:
- Timely diagnosis and tailored treatment strategies are crucial for maximizing survival and quality of life in HCC patients.
- Transplantation is reserved for HCC patients with significant underlying liver dysfunction.
- A multidisciplinary approach integrating various therapies optimizes HCC management.
